Benefits & More
  • Supports heart health: The dietary fibre and potassium present in tuar dal contribute to heart health. Dietary fibre helps in reducing cholesterol levels, while potassium helps in maintaining healthy blood pressure levels.
  • Helps in Weight management - Tuar dal is relatively low in calories and high in dietary fibre, which can contribute to weight management.
  • Enhances digestion - The fiber content in tuar dal promotes healthy digestion by adding bulk to the stool and preventing constipation. It also helps in maintaining a healthy gut microbiota.
  • Supports muscle growth and repair - Tuar dal's protein content plays a vital role in muscle growth and repair. It provides essential amino acids that are necessary for the synthesis and maintenance of muscles.
  • Boosts immune system - Tuar dal contains Vitamin C, vitamin B6, iron, and zinc that support a healthy immune system.
  • Promotes brain health - The B vitamins present in tuar dal, such as thiamine and niacin, are essential for brain health and function. They help in maintaining proper cognitive function and support the nervous system.
  • Supports bone health - Tuar dal contains minerals like magnesium, potassium, and calcium, which are crucial for maintaining healthy bones and preventing conditions like osteoporosis

 Tuar / Arhar Dal Benefits for Health

  • Tuar dal is a good source of essential nutrients such as protein, dietary fibre, vitamins, and minerals. It contains folate, magnesium, potassium, iron, and vitamin B complex, including vitamin B1 (thiamine), B3 (niacin), and B9 (folic acid).
  • Tuar dal is an excellent plant-based source of protein. Protein is essential for building and repairing tissues, promoting muscle growth, and supporting various functions in the body.
  • Tuar dal is rich in dietary fibre, which aids in digestion, prevents constipation, and promotes a healthy digestive system. It can help regulate bowel movements and maintain optimal gut health.
  • Tuar dal has a low glycemic index (GI), which means it releases glucose into the bloodstream at a slower rate. This makes it suitable for individuals with diabetes as it helps in managing blood sugar levels.
  • Tuar dal provides a good amount of carbohydrates, which are a primary source of energy for the body. Including tuar dal in your diet can help in providing sustained energy throughout the day.

 Tuar / Arhar Dal Uses

  • Due to its high protein and fibre content, tuar dal is often used as a thickening agent in soups, stews, and gravies.
  • Tuar dal is commonly cooked as a dal in Indian cuisine. It is typically boiled and seasoned with various spices and herbs.
  • Tuar dal is a key ingredient in sambar, a popular South Indian lentil stew. It is combined with vegetables, tamarind, and a unique blend of spices.
  • Tuar dal is an essential component of khichdi, a comforting one-pot dish made with rice and lentils.
